eSpeak NG is an open source speech synthesizer that supports more than hundred languages and accents.
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

tk_rules 1.1K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119
  1. // This file is UTF8 encoded
  2. // Spelling to phoneme rules for Turkmen language
  3. // Letter groups
  4. .L01 a o u y
  5. .L02 ä e i ö ü
  6. .replace
  7. // Replace non-standard letters
  8. ñ ň
  9. ÿ ý
  10. .group a
  11. a A
  12. .group ä
  13. ä &
  14. .group b
  15. b b
  16. .group ç
  17. ç tS
  18. .group d
  19. d d
  20. .group e
  21. e e
  22. .group f
  23. f f,
  24. .group g
  25. g g
  26. g (L01 Q"
  27. g (L02 g
  28. L01) g Q"
  29. L02) g g
  30. .group h
  31. h h
  32. h (L01 x
  33. h (L02 h
  34. L01) h x
  35. L02) h h
  36. .group i
  37. i i
  38. .group j
  39. j dZ
  40. .group k
  41. k k
  42. k (L01 q
  43. k (L02 k
  44. L01) k q
  45. L02) k k
  46. .group l
  47. l l
  48. l (L01 L
  49. l (L02 l
  50. L01) l L
  51. L02) l l
  52. .group m
  53. m m
  54. .group n
  55. n n
  56. .group ň
  57. ň N
  58. .group o
  59. o o
  60. .group ö
  61. ö W
  62. .group p
  63. p p
  64. .group r
  65. r R
  66. .group s
  67. s T
  68. .group ş
  69. ş S
  70. .group t
  71. t t
  72. ts ts
  73. .group u
  74. u U
  75. .group ü
  76. ü Y
  77. üý Y:
  78. .group w
  79. w B
  80. .group y
  81. y @
  82. .group ý
  83. ý j
  84. .group z
  85. z D
  86. .group ž
  87. ž Z